Before the UTRGV merger, the University of Texas–Pan American sponsored eight men's and nine women's teams in NCAA-sanctioned sports. About a year before the merger, the UT System announced that UTRGV would inherit the UTPA athletic program, [ 34 ] and the UTPA Broncs officially became the UTRGV Vaqueros on July 1, 2015.
